111 votes

MySQL Diff Tool

Personne ne sait tout visuel MySQL outils diff?

J'ai environ 10 machines, toutes avec leur propre instance de MySQL. Pas de réplication a lieu, puisque chaque machine agit indépendamment des autres. Cependant, leurs structures de table doivent être identiques, et je voudrais un moyen rapide de vérifier leurs structures de la table.

Je ne suis pas tellement préoccupés par les données dans les tables. Toutefois, si l'outil prend en charge les données de la table des comparaisons, j'aimerais bien sûr à vérifier que, trop.

Si vous avez travaillé avec un bon outil de ligne de commande, je suis ouvert à ça aussi.

EDIT: les Outils mentionnés dans les réponses:

54voto

Stefan Gehrig Points 47227

Toad® for MySQL peut faire à la fois un "Schema Compare" et un "Data Compare" (et beaucoup plus).

Au fait, le logiciel est gratuit - au cas où quelqu'un le demanderait.

22voto

stepancheg Points 2229

Essayez mysql-diff . Il fait un bon travail en comparant les structures des tables, mais ne supporte pas toutes les fonctionnalités MySQL modernes. C'est en ligne de commande et gratuit.

8voto

Devart Points 52715

Vous devriez jeter un coup d'oeil aux outils de comparaison de base de données de Devart pour MySQL:

5voto

user505700 Points 41

SQLYog peut le faire aussi.

5voto

noonex Points 935

Prograide.com

Prograide est une communauté de développeurs qui cherche à élargir la connaissance de la programmation au-delà de l'anglais.
Pour cela nous avons les plus grands doutes résolus en français et vous pouvez aussi poser vos propres questions ou résoudre celles des autres.

Powered by:

X